Finishes the supervise data-plane writers for the shared gateway. Both
still keyed off a single SUPERVISE_BOTTLE_SLUG env; now each proposal is
attributed to the calling bottle, keeping slices 10/11's per-bottle model.
- git_http_backend: in consolidated mode stamp SUPERVISE_BOTTLE_SLUG=
<bottle_id> into the CGI env. The gitleaks-allow pre-receive hook runs as
a child of the `git http-backend` we spawn, so it inherits the stamp and
queues under the right bottle — no change to the (fragile) embedded hook.
The bottle id is the namespaced root's final component (slice 10), the
same key egress uses. Single-tenant leaves the container-stamped slug.
- supervise_server: resolve the proposal slug per request by source IP when
BOT_BOTTLE_ORCHESTRATOR_URL is set (`_attributed_config`), fail-closed —
an unattributed / unreachable source raises rather than queue under the
wrong or empty slug. `serve`/`main` build + attach the resolver and make
the env slug optional in consolidated mode. Single-tenant unchanged.
Tests: a real git push proving the slug reaches the hook's env; the
supervise attribution matrix (single-tenant slug kept, source-IP bottle
bound, unattributed + resolver-error fail closed).
Remaining supervise gap (noted): websocket DLP still self.config-only.

Closes#255. Without timeouts, a hung upstream during the access-hook
or git http-backend CGI call (git_http_backend.py) and a stalled Gitea
API during deploy-key provisioning (contrib/gitea/deploy_key_provisioner.py)
could wedge a sidecar indefinitely. Adds GIT_HTTP_BACKEND_TIMEOUT_SECS
(30s) to both subprocess.run calls in the HTTP backend, mirroring the
existing GIT_GATE_DAEMON_TIMEOUT_SECS on the daemon path. Adds
_API_TIMEOUT_SECS (30s) and _KEYGEN_TIMEOUT_SECS (10s) to the Gitea
provisioner's urlopen and ssh-keygen calls. Tests verify the timeout
values are forwarded in all four call sites.
An empty or non-numeric Status: header from git http-backend raised
ValueError/IndexError that escaped the handler thread. Wrap the parse
in a try/except and fall back to HTTP 500 instead.

Previously when the access-hook returned non-zero, git-http would pipe
the hook's stderr into the 403 body sent back to the agent's git
client but never log it locally, so docker logs just showed
`"GET ... 403 -"` with no explanation. Operators had to shell into
the sidecar and re-run the hook by hand to find out why a clone was
being refused (e.g. upstream SSH unreachable, missing credentials).
Route the hook's stderr/stdout through the existing log_message
channel before sending the 403, one log line per output line so the
default request-log format stays readable. When the hook exits
non-zero with no output, log the exit code so the line is still
informative.

Before this change, int() on a non-numeric Content-Length raised an
unhandled ValueError, crashing the request handler. There was also no
upper bound on how much memory a POST body could consume.
After this change:
- Non-numeric or missing Content-Length returns HTTP 400.
- Negative Content-Length returns HTTP 400.
- Bodies declared larger than 1 MiB (_MAX_BODY_BYTES) return HTTP 413,
matching the cap already in supervise_server.py.
